How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Nipton?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Nipton Studio Apartments | $1,704 | $1,190 | $2,424 |
Nipton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,760 | $1,186 | $4,368 |
Nipton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,141 | $1,434 | $6,014 |
Nipton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,549 | $1,798 | $3,928 |
